I took $ out of my 401(k)due to a financial emergency, totaling 18K. Can I add that full amount in the "Distributions not subject to Additional Tax?" Or is there a limit?

    For a personal emergency, you can draw up to $1,000, once a year. This disposition is new in 2024.
